Career path

Career Role (Certified Professional in Textile Garment Construction) Description
Textile Garment Construction Specialist Highly skilled in pattern making, cutting, and garment assembly. Expertise in various sewing techniques and fabric manipulation.
Senior Garment Technologist Leads the technical design and production processes, ensuring quality and efficiency in garment manufacturing. Strong knowledge of textile properties and construction methods.
Quality Control Manager (Textiles) Oversees quality assurance throughout the textile garment production process, identifying and resolving defects. Manages a team and implements quality control measures.
Pattern Cutter (Garment Construction) Creates and grades patterns for various sizes and styles of garments, ensuring a precise fit and efficient material usage. Proficient in CAD software.
Sewing Machine Operator (High-Speed) Operates industrial sewing machines at high speeds, producing high-quality garments with speed and precision.

A Certified Professional in Textile Garment Construction certification program equips individuals with comprehensive knowledge and practical skills in garment manufacturing. Successful completion demonstrates mastery of pattern making, sewing techniques, quality control, and industrial best practices.


Learning outcomes typically include proficiency in various sewing machine operations, understanding of different textile fabrics and their properties (like cotton, silk, and synthetics), advanced pattern drafting and alterations, and the ability to construct garments with precision and efficiency. Grasping industrial standards and production timelines is also crucial.


The duration of a Certified Professional in Textile Garment Construction program varies depending on the institution and the intensity of the course. Programs range from several weeks for concentrated courses to a year or more for comprehensive programs that delve into specialized areas like apparel design or sustainable fashion practices.
